Why do Cats like Feet?

Cats are fascinating creatures, and their behavior can sometimes be quite perplexing. One of the most common mysteries that cat owners face is why their cats seem to be so obsessed with their feet. Whether it’s kneading, licking, or just rubbing against them, cats seem to have a particular fondness for our feet, and it’s not always clear why. In this article, we will explore some of the possible reasons why cats might like feet so much.

One of the first things to consider is the scent. Cats have an incredibly keen sense of smell, and they use this sense to explore their surroundings and gather information about the world around them. When they rub against your feet or lick your toes, they may be trying to gather more information about you and your environment. Additionally, the scent of your feet can be comforting to your cat, and they may associate it with safety, security, and love.

Another possible reason why cats like feet is because of the texture. Cats have incredibly sensitive paws, and they love to feel different textures. Your feet may provide a new and interesting texture for your cat to explore, and they may find it comforting or satisfying to knead or rub against them. Additionally, the sensation of your feet may be soothing to your cat, especially if they are feeling stressed or nervous.

Cats also love to show affection to their owners, and feet can be a great way for them to do this. By rubbing against your feet, licking your toes, or just lying next to them, your cat may be trying to express their love and affection for you. Additionally, by kneading your feet, your cat may be trying to create a sense of comfort and security.

Finally, cats may like feet simply because they are a convenient target. Cats are naturally curious creatures, and they love to explore their environment. Your feet may be within easy reach for your cat, and they may simply be drawn to them as a result. Additionally, if your cat is feeling playful, your feet may be a fun target to bat around or chase.
